La Cena (o Convito) di San Gregorio Magno è un capolavoro dipinto nel 1572 da Paolo Veronese, grande pittore del Rinascimento, che operò soprattutto a Venezia entrando a far parte integrante della scuola veneziana assieme a Tiziano e al Tintoretto. Il dipinto è un olio su tela lungo 8,62 m. e alto 4,77 m., non proprio un quadro da salotto; infatti ricopre l'intera parete di fondo del refettorio del convento dei frati Serviti di Monte Berico. La grande tela rappresenta una delle famose Cene del Veronese, che gli costarono le critiche del Tribunale dell'Inquisizione ( Cena in casa Levi). Questa Cena di San Gregorio Magno è risorta dalle sue ceneri, infatti nel 1848 i soldati austriaci che occupavano Vicenza si divertirono a lanciare le loro baionette sul quadro e a tagliarlo alla fine in 32 pezzi. Fortunatamente un frate previdente raccolse tutti i pezzi e supplicò l'imperatore Francesco Giuseppe a farlo restaurare; quest'ultimo acconsentì e 10 anni più tardi ritornò al suo posto dove si può ammirare tutt'ora; purtroppo qualche piccola ferita è rimasta, la si può notare sul pavimento antistante la tavola, ma considerato com'era ridotto è un miracolo che sia arrivato ai giorni nostri.
